Roof tiles, unlike shingles, can be costly and needs expert setup. This is due to its considerably heavy weight and the fragility of the material. Clay and concrete are the most common roofing system tiles that are being used. Home and other structure constructions that utilize concrete tiles require to have a well-supported framework to keep the tiles in place for quite at some point.
trendy and trendy houses is slate. It looks like shingles but in a rock composition, and it can be as heavy as a concrete tile. Like tiles, it requires a strong structure for it to be nailed in place. Both tiles and slate are great choice for toughness and endurance. Also, they need less upkeep as compared to wood shakes.
A relatively becoming more extensively utilized roofing material nowadays is metal roof. nearly see them on homes nearly all over due to the fact that of its proven sturdiness and long-lasting worth. It does not get consumed by fire and is quite maintenance-free. This is reasonably light compared to the rest of the roof materials when it comes to weight.

A flat roof system works by providing a water resistant membrane over a building. It includes one or more layers of hydrophobic products that is put over a structural deck with a vapor barrier that is typically put between the roofing and the deck membrane.
Flashing, or thin strips of product such as copper, intersect with the membrane and the other building components to avoid water infiltration. The water is then directed to drains, downspouts, and gutters by the roofing's slight pitch.
There are 4 most common kinds of flat roofing systems. Noted in order of increasing durability and expense, they are: roll asphalt, single-ply membrane, built-up or multiple-ply, and flat-seamed metal. They can vary anywhere from as low as $2 per square foot for roll asphalt or single-ply roof that is used over and existing roof, to $20 per square foot or more for brand-new metal roofings.
Utilized since the 1890s, asphalt roll roofing usually includes one layer of asphalt-saturated organic or fiberglass base felts that are used over roofing system felt with nails and cold asphalt cement and normally covered with a granular mineral surface area. The seams are typically covered over with a roofing compound. It can last about 10 years.
Single-ply membrane roofing is the most recent kind of roofing material. It is typically used to change multiple-ply roofing systems. 10 to 12 year guarantees are normal, but appropriate installation is vital and maintenance is still required.
Multiple-ply or built-up roof, likewise known as BUR, is made of overlapping rolls of saturated or coated felts or mats that are sprinkled with layers of bitumen and appeared with a granular roof tile, sheet, or ballast pavers that are used to protect the hidden products from the weather. BURs are developed to last 10 to 30 years, which depends upon the materials utilized.
Ballast, or aggregate, of crushed stone or water-worn gravel is embedded in a finish of asphalt or coal tar. Given that the ballast or tile pavers cover the membrane, it makes checking and keeping the joints of the roofing tough.
Flat-seamed roofings have actually been used because the 19 th century. Made from little pieces of sheet metal soldered flush at the joints, it can last many decades depending upon the quality of the product, exposure, and maintenance to the elements.
Galvanized metal does require regular painting in order to prevent rust and split seams require to be resoldered. Other metal surface areas, such as copper, can become pitted and pinholed from acid raid and normally requires changing. Today copper, lead-coated copper, and terne-coated stainless steel are preferred as lasting flat roofings.
